1 : Consider the Size of Your Group
The size of your travel group plays a major role in determining the right vehicle:
Solo Travelers or Couples: A compact car is ideal for navigating narrow roads and saving on fuel costs.
Small Families or Groups (3-7 people): A van or a spacious mini bus provides the comfort and room you need.
Larger Groups (8+ people): Opt for a mini-coach or coach to ensure everyone travels together comfortably.
2 : Evaluate Your Travel Itinerary
Your destinations influence the type of vehicle you’ll need:
City Tours: A Tuktuk, small car or sedan is perfect for urban areas like Colombo and Galle.
Hill Country: An SUV or 4x4 is recommended for hilly terrain and winding roads. A normal vehicle like car, van or bus can be used in most of the Hilly Terrain in Sri Lanka.
Off-the-Beaten-Path Destinations: For areas with unpaved roads, a sturdy vehicle like a Jeep or 4x4 is essential. Specially for safaris.
Beach Hopping: A comfortable sedan or van works well for coastal routes.
3 : Prioritize Comfort
Long hours on the road can be tiring, so comfort is key. Look for vehicles with:
Ample legroom and seating capacity.
Air conditioning to combat Sri Lanka’s tropical climate.
Smooth suspension for bumpy roads.
4 : Assess Luggage Space
Consider how much luggage you or your group will carry:
Compact cars may have limited trunk space.
SUVs and vans offer more room for suitcases, backpacks, and other gear.
If you plan to shop or carry sports equipment (e.g., surfboards), ensure the vehicle can accommodate it.
5 : Factor in Fuel Efficiency
Fuel prices can impact your travel budget. Choose a fuel-efficient vehicle, especially if your itinerary involves long distances or multiple destinations.
6 : Account for Driver Preferences
If you’re renting a vehicle with a private driver, discuss their preferences and experience:
Many drivers are accustomed to specific vehicle types.
Experienced drivers can handle larger or more challenging vehicles on tricky roads.
7 : Check for Safety Features
Safety should always come first. Ensure your chosen vehicle includes:
Seat belts for all passengers.
Propper vehicle insurance.
Properly maintained brakes and tires.
Airbags and other safety enhancements.
8 : Consider Eco-Friendly Options
For travelers looking to reduce their environmental impact, hybrid or electric vehicles are great choices. Some rental services offer eco-friendly options that align with sustainable travel practices.
9 : Budget Wisely
Vehicle rental prices can vary significantly. Compare options and balance cost with features:
Compact cars are typically more affordable.
SUVs and vans are pricier but provide added comfort and space.
Consider additional costs like insurance, driver fees, and fuel.
10 : Consult a Local Rental Service
Local car rental providers are familiar with Sri Lanka’s unique travel needs. They can:
Recommend the best vehicle based on your itinerary.
Provide vehicles equipped for Sri Lankan roads.
Offer packages that include a private driver, fuel, and insurance.
